Type
ORACLE
Validation date
2024-03-25 03: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03312,
    "usd": 0.03583
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C821A98ED84FC578D139A36352137B2515B1D116E08190EAEB4209C21131049E

Previous signature

04014540F1EA40D373CC9594356B3D0E1931A53DD708BC000426D8AFFD3BB03D61BB6755A490F922975005473A7F3A7435FEBDC1578282AD9AE666E7B2DE5805

Origin signature

304502206E8CC584988710B3D637C6F9753ABD2D82BD45A05B1EB24259EE4E3BCF3AC24C022100AFFCDB77145513CE2D0789E615EC05FABDC474FC39EB570AA4FDDB8590C506D5

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

00870F55360AD51C81CFE979A18377DD1554BE2DFE0C0B7EEF3DDA4BF55CBF7DC6

Coordinator signature

C018E808A80DD3AB795ABFA30A8CEB57F035A27F972DABA8CAEE9975B383CF027997DE7AFD253720BC440310C249820E7019824EF4494A78B886D6499D476503

Validator #1 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#1 signature

78F797190906389404114D8F9BA1002EE54D56F0E741926B8926EAD9C0BD636471F8CD77B97EBE1F2B83ED76FAD27C877056588257FCBA7DFBF010C60E208409

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

54F3F61AB979C19078ABC742A62EBFB7C3A2951B3DF3C24E981153C9A62218D289FBB085CD37C4F95712D3E060D3EC5DA651967A264457900E36A54213B09601